It's called a rice worm that grows inside the rice. You can pick up some garlic and put it in the rice bucket. Then pick up more than ten or twenty pieces of garlic, stir them with a blender, flush them into cold water, and then filter them to filter out the dregs of the garlic.
You can use the water to wipe the insects. Wipe it and ignore it. Wipe it again the next day.
That's pretty much the time. My house was crawling with little white worms everywhere for the first two days, and now they are all gone.
